[0001] This application relates to the field of household appliance technology, such as a clothes drying rod assembly and a clothes drying machine. Background Technology
[0002] An electric clothes drying rack is a type of clothes drying rack equipped with an automatic lifting device. Because it can be installed in the ceiling and is easy to use, it is increasingly being chosen by users. An electric clothes drying rack generally consists of a main unit and a clothes drying rod. The main unit has a drive unit that is connected to the clothes drying rod to move it up or down.
[0003] In related technologies, to improve the utilization rate of clotheslines, telescopic rods are usually installed on them. This allows the telescopic rod to extend to one side of the clothesline when drying clothes, thereby increasing the drying space.
[0004] In the process of implementing the embodiments of this disclosure, at least the following problems were found in the related art:
[0005] In existing technologies, the clothes drying rods of current clothes drying racks are generally quite large, which may cause the rods to protrude from the main unit. This makes the presence of the bracket and the drying rod clearly visible to users from the front and sides, resulting in a less aesthetically pleasing appearance and a poor user experience.

[0046] Specifically, the clothes drying rack also includes a main unit 10, which is installed in the ceiling and can drive the bracket 21 to move vertically. The bracket 21 includes two clothes drying rods 211 and two side plates 12, which are perpendicular to each other. The two side plates 12 are located at both ends of the two clothes drying rods 211, and the two ends of the side plates 12 are fastened to the clothes drying rods 211 by screws. In this way, the two side plates 12 and the two clothes drying rods 211 can be fixed to each other to form a ring-shaped bracket 21. Furthermore, the distance between the two clothes drying rods 211 is greater than the length of the side plates 12, so that there is a gap between the clothes drying rods 211 and the side plates 12 to allow space for the telescopic rod 23. The clothes drying rod 211 has a groove 2111 along its extension direction, and the length of the groove 2111 is greater than or equal to the length of the telescopic rod 23. The telescopic rod 23 is inserted into the groove 2111 to extend and retract within the clothes drying rod 211. A pull rod 23 is connected to the end of the telescopic rod 23 facing away from the clothes drying rod 211. The two ends of the pull rod 23 are respectively connected to the ends of the two telescopic rods 23, and the pull rod 23 is located on the side of the connecting rod 212 facing away from the clothes drying rod 211. In this way, when the user is drying clothes, the telescopic rod 23 can be pulled out from the clothes drying rod 211 by the pull rod 23 to increase the drying space of the clothes drying machine. When the user does not need to dry clothes or has only a small amount of clothes, the telescopic rod 23 can be pushed back into the clothes drying rod 211 by the pull rod 23 to retract the telescopic rod 23 within the clothes drying rod 211, thereby reducing the area occupied by the clothes drying machine. Meanwhile, a first storage groove 2121 is provided on the side of the connecting rod 212 facing the pull rod 23, and the size of the first storage groove 2121 is greater than or equal to the size of the pull rod 23. With this configuration, when the telescopic rod 23 is retracted into the clothes drying rod 211, the pull rod 23 can be completely stored in the first storage groove 2121, thereby improving the aesthetics of the clothes drying rack and thus enhancing the user experience.

[0095] like Figure 9 As shown, a leveling nut 2114 is provided at the end of the hanging section 2113, and the leveling nut 2114 is located on the upper surface of the hanging section 2113. The position of the leveling nut 2114 corresponds to the traction rope, and the leveling nut 2114 is provided with a leveling groove corresponding to the traction rope. The end of the traction rope is connected to the leveling groove of the leveling nut 2114. It is understood that the drive assembly 16 is generally provided with multiple traction ropes to connect to multiple corners or sides of the drying rod assembly 20 respectively, so the drying rod assembly 20 may tilt. At this time, by rotating the corresponding leveling nut 2114, the leveling nut 2114 can be moved up or down relative to the hanging section 2113, thereby causing any corner or side of the clothes drying rod 211 to move down or up relative to other corners and sides, thus achieving the effect of leveling the drying rod assembly 20.
